具有多个相同类型的一对多关系的实体和GreenDAO

时间:2013-07-04 23:56:52

标签: android database orm one-to-many greendao

GreenDAO生成的实体必须是这样的:

class A {    
    public List<B> bList1;
    public List<B> bList2;    
}

class B{
    ...
}

我知道它如何在给定类型的列表上工作。

问题是我不确定生成的代码是否可以知道B对象是bList1还是bList2。

1 个答案:

答案 0 :(得分:0)

是的,它可以:您可以为每个关系命名。在B班,你会有类似的东西:

class B {
  A aRelation1;
  A aRelation2;
}